A filtration is an indexed family of nested mathematical objects. In probability theory, a filtration
on a probability space
is a nondecreasing family of sigma-algebras
satisfying
|
(1)
|
The sigma-algebra represents the information available by time
. This form of filtration is used in the definitions of a stopping time, martingale,
and stochastic integrals.
In algebra, a filtration of ideals of a commutative unit ring is a sequence of ideals
|
(2)
|
such that
for all indices
.
An example is the
-adic
filtration associated with a proper ideal
of
,
|
(3)
|
A ring equipped with a filtration is called a filtered ring.
